The constant images of the past flicker into his mind once again, the gore and blood that led him here in the first place. He enters the city walls a leather bag dangles at his side, so many people call him crazy for embarking on this journey. Well....He wished they did, Alex lived alone and Hardly had any person to talk to except maybe on the occasion when he would get a letter in the post. Alex inherited a large estate from his parents after they where killed going off the side of a cliff in a car. Alex can't help but remember the entire bloody scene. Their mangled bodies being pulled out of a car in a river, nobody every managed to figure out how it got so far down stream.
Alex Maneuvers past the multitudes of people, he finally reaches his inn after about an hour in the city. He enters the small unkempt inn, immediately the mixture of a musty cologne and another strong Oder he couldn't quite pinpoint filled the air. It almost made him want to vomit. The setup of the inn is much like another inn he had been in: Lounge to the left, receptionist to the right and straight ahead was a tavern along with some stairs that led up to the floor with his living arrangements he would have to get used to for the next few months.
Alex walks to the Reception, Conveniently there is already someone standing there the woman looked about his age, seventeen to twenty years old, about his height as well. The eyes are what got his attention, it was almost like he was thrown into a trance..... After what seemed like hours of small talk Alex got his room key and made his way into his room for the night. But before ever leaving the commons room the receptionist said a few words that were almost unnerving to Alex. "Welcome to the City..... Alexander." It was odd because he had not heard his correct name said to him since his parents died. Just the thought of it sent chills down Alex's spine.
